Position Summary:
As an HR Business Partner Senior Manager, you will work closely with senior management within specific business units or regions to develop and implement predominately medium to long-term HR solutions aligned to business strategy. Supported by centralized HR professionals who have specialized in particular functions.
You will accomplish this by:
· Collaborating with senior executives and business leaders to understand the organization's strategic direction and translate it into Human Resources strategies and initiatives.
· Assessing the organization's structure, identifying opportunities for optimization, and developing strategies to enhance organizational effectiveness.
· Providing thought leadership and strategic advice on people-related issues, helping to shape the overall business strategy.
· Leading or participating in Human Resources projects or initiatives aimed at enhancing Human Resources processes, employee engagement, or diversity and inclusion efforts.
· Utilizing Human Resources data and analytics to provide insights and recommendations to business leaders by analyzing workforce data, identifying trends, and developing metrics to measure the effectiveness of HR programs and initiatives.
· Providing strategic Human Resources guidance, influencing decision-making, and fostering strong partnerships across the organization.
· Supporting change management initiatives and fostering employee engagement within the organization by helping leaders effectively communicate and managing change, anticipating, and addressing employee concerns, and creating strategies to foster a positive and inclusive work environment.
· Providing guidance and support to business leaders on employee relations matters and performance management.
· Ensuring Human Resources policies and practices strictly align with legal requirements and industry regulations.
Required Qualifications
· 7+ years of Human Resource experience
· Strong Workday experience
· Experience cultivating relationships
· Proven experience with cross collaboration
· Experience driving data to move metrics
· Willingness to travel up to 20% (Kansas City, Novi, and Indianapolis)
Preferred Qualifications
Society for Human Resource Management Certified Professional (SHRM-CP) Certification
Education
Bachelor’s Degree required; equivalent work experience may substitute.
Pay Range
The typical pay range for this role is:
$75,400.00 - $165,954.00
This pay range represents the base hourly rate or base annual full-time salary for all positions in the job grade within which this position falls. The actual base salary offer will depend on a variety of factors including experience, education, geography and other relevant factors. This position is eligible for a CVS Health bonus, commission or short-term incentive program in addition to the base pay range listed above. This position also includes an award target in the company’s equity award program.
